It looks on the surface like an FPS, but it's more of an RTS. R6S is this weird bastard child of a shooter and a living puzzle. If you're going into R6S thinking being an aim god is going to make you good, you're wrong. Someone who couldn't 1v1 a toddler on CoD or CSGO has put a small hole in a wall somewhere, holding an angle that you happen to cross. You have to think before you move. Obviously being able to aim helps, but I think R6S is the best team based shooter for someone who isn't great at the shooting part of shooters.
As a 7 year vet, my advice to new plays is to learn: •How to play vertically •How to play off of sound •How to be patient when sneaking • and most importantly, map knowledge
